commit:     85158026a6962c95119add10dd1d858d26d3a447
Author:     Andreas Sturmlechner <asturm <AT> gentoo <DOT> org>
AuthorDate: Wed Nov 16 19:03:59 2022 +0000
Commit:     Andreas Sturmlechner <asturm <AT> gentoo <DOT> org>
CommitDate: Wed Nov 16 19:07:18 2022 +0000
URL:        https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=85158026

kde-apps/okular: Drop version check broken by KF-5.100

Upstream commit d25eaebc8004aa69b4eca3cacfef2701e728c8ef

Signed-off-by: Andreas Sturmlechner <asturm <AT> gentoo.org>

 ...ular-22.08.3-drop-broken-kf-version-check.patch | 30 ++++++++++++++++++++++
 kde-apps/okular/okular-22.08.3.ebuild              |  1 +
 2 files changed, 31 insertions(+)

diff --git 
a/kde-apps/okular/files/okular-22.08.3-drop-broken-kf-version-check.patch 
b/kde-apps/okular/files/okular-22.08.3-drop-broken-kf-version-check.patch
new file mode 100644
index 000000000000..610f36663d27
--- /dev/null
+++ b/kde-apps/okular/files/okular-22.08.3-drop-broken-kf-version-check.patch
@@ -0,0 +1,30 @@
+From d25eaebc8004aa69b4eca3cacfef2701e728c8ef Mon Sep 17 00:00:00 2001
+From: Jonathan Esk-Riddell <[email protected]>
+Date: Fri, 21 Oct 2022 11:47:53 +0100
+Subject: [PATCH] remove ecm_version check which breaks on 5.100, we already
+ depend on ecm 5.68 anyway so it serves no purpose
+
+---
+ CMakeLists.txt | 6 +-----
+ 1 file changed, 1 insertion(+), 5 deletions(-)
+
+diff --git a/CMakeLists.txt b/CMakeLists.txt
+index 98cfd2b17..3817078c2 100644
+--- a/CMakeLists.txt
++++ b/CMakeLists.txt
+@@ -611,11 +611,7 @@ install(FILES okular.upd DESTINATION 
${KDE_INSTALL_KCONFUPDATEDIR})
+ install( FILES okular_part.desktop  DESTINATION  ${KDE_INSTALL_KSERVICES5DIR} 
)
+ install( FILES part/part.rc part/part-viewermode.rc DESTINATION 
${KDE_INSTALL_KXMLGUI5DIR}/okular )
+ 
+-if (${ECM_VERSION} STRGREATER "5.58.0")
+-    install(FILES okular.categories  DESTINATION  
${KDE_INSTALL_LOGGINGCATEGORIESDIR})
+-else()
+-    install(FILES okular.categories  DESTINATION ${KDE_INSTALL_CONFDIR})
+-endif()
++install(FILES okular.categories  DESTINATION  
${KDE_INSTALL_LOGGINGCATEGORIESDIR})
+ 
+ ki18n_install(po)
+ if(KF5DocTools_FOUND)
+-- 
+GitLab
+

diff --git a/kde-apps/okular/okular-22.08.3.ebuild 
b/kde-apps/okular/okular-22.08.3.ebuild
index 9693c79978ad..2bd095913a16 100644
--- a/kde-apps/okular/okular-22.08.3.ebuild
+++ b/kde-apps/okular/okular-22.08.3.ebuild
@@ -70,6 +70,7 @@ RDEPEND="${DEPEND}
 PATCHES=(
        "${FILESDIR}/${PN}-21.11.80-tests.patch" # bug 734138
        "${FILESDIR}/${PN}-20.08.2-hide-mobile-app.patch" # avoid same-name 
entry
+       "${FILESDIR}/${P}-drop-broken-kf-version-check.patch"
 )
 
 src_configure() {

Reply via email to